Excel如何实现对应关系自动填充?如何快速设置?
作者:佚名|分类:EXCEL|浏览:194|发布时间:2025-03-27 13:40:00
Excel如何实现对应关系自动填充?如何快速设置?
在处理Excel数据时,经常需要将一个列表中的数据与另一个列表中的数据进行匹配,以实现数据的自动填充。这种对应关系的自动填充不仅可以提高工作效率,还可以减少人为错误。下面,我将详细介绍如何在Excel中实现对应关系的自动填充,以及如何快速设置。
一、Excel实现对应关系自动填充的方法
1. 使用VLOOKUP函数
VLOOKUP函数是Excel中常用的查找与引用函数,可以实现对应关系的自动填充。以下是使用VLOOKUP函数实现对应关系自动填充的步骤:
(1)在需要填充对应关系的单元格中输入公式:“=VLOOKUP(查找值,查找范围,返回列数,查找方式)”。
(2)查找值:需要查找的值,可以是单元格引用或常量。
(3)查找范围:包含查找值的列,需要指定查找列的起始单元格和结束单元格。
(4)返回列数:需要返回的列数,从查找范围的第二列开始计数。
(5)查找方式:可选参数,0表示精确匹配,-1表示按升序排列的查找范围进行模糊匹配,1表示按降序排列的查找范围进行模糊匹配。
2. 使用INDEX和MATCH函数
INDEX和MATCH函数结合使用可以实现类似VLOOKUP的功能,且不受数据结构限制。以下是使用INDEX和MATCH函数实现对应关系自动填充的步骤:
(1)在需要填充对应关系的单元格中输入公式:“=INDEX(数据范围,MATCH(查找值,数据范围,0))”。
(2)数据范围:包含查找值和对应值的列。
(3)查找值:需要查找的值。
(4)MATCH函数的第三个参数:0表示精确匹配。
二、如何快速设置对应关系自动填充
1. 使用数据验证功能
(1)选中需要填充对应关系的单元格。
(2)点击“数据”选项卡,选择“数据验证”。
(3)在“设置”选项卡中,选择“允许”为“序列”。
(4)在“来源”框中输入对应关系的列表,可以使用冒号分隔多个值。
(5)点击“确定”按钮,即可快速设置对应关系自动填充。
2. 使用条件格式功能
(1)选中需要填充对应关系的单元格。
(2)点击“开始”选项卡,选择“条件格式”。
(3)选择“新建规则”,在弹出的对话框中选择“使用公式确定要设置格式的单元格”。
(4)在“格式值等于以下公式时”框中输入公式:“=ISNUMBER(MATCH($A2,$B$2:$B$10,0))”,其中$A2为查找值,$B$2:$B$10为对应关系的列表。
(5)点击“格式”按钮,设置单元格格式。
(6)点击“确定”按钮,即可快速设置对应关系自动填充。
三、相关问答
1. 问答VLOOKUP函数和INDEX和MATCH函数有什么区别?
问答内容:VLOOKUP函数和INDEX和MATCH函数都可以实现对应关系的自动填充,但VLOOKUP函数受数据结构限制,只能从左向右查找,而INDEX和MATCH函数不受此限制,可以灵活运用。
2. 问答如何设置数据验证功能实现对应关系自动填充?
问答内容:在Excel中,选中需要填充对应关系的单元格,点击“数据”选项卡,选择“数据验证”,在“设置”选项卡中,选择“允许”为“序列”,在“来源”框中输入对应关系的列表,点击“确定”按钮即可。
3. 问答如何使用条件格式功能实现对应关系自动填充?
问答内容:在Excel中,选中需要填充对应关系的单元格,点击“开始”选项卡,选择“条件格式”,选择“新建规则”,在弹出的对话框中选择“使用公式确定要设置格式的单元格”,在“格式值等于以下公式时”框中输入公式,设置单元格格式,点击“确定”按钮即可。
通过以上介绍,相信大家对Excel实现对应关系自动填充的方法和快速设置方法有了更深入的了解。在实际应用中,可以根据具体需求选择合适的方法,提高工作效率。